#a1d2be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a1d2be is composed of 63.1% red, 82.4% green and 74.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 9.5%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 155.5 degrees, a saturation of 35.3% and a lightness of 72.7%. #a1d2be color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#43a57d. Closest websafe color is: #99cccc.

Shades and Tints of #a1d2be

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060c0a is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.
